I will govern my personal actions while at camp to reflect the mission statement of TAF. I will promote a commitment to personal growth and leadership in the Taiwanese-American community. I also understand that TAF does not allow smoking, alcohol or non-prescription drugs.
I will promote TAF as a safe place for all campers where they can seek out their own personal beliefs. I will also encourage campers to challenge their limits and to grow as an individual. I will make an extended effort to help all campers feel comfortable and at ease. I will provide campers with the opportunity to be a vital part of a group that is positive, socially comfortable, emotionally satisfying, and mentally stimulating. I will treat people equally and with respect.
I will strive to maintain open lines of communication with fellow staff members, and if there is a problem between another staff member and myself, I will report to my program director and/or executive director for assistance.
I understand that TAF offers a wide variety of events and activities and that I may be asked to participate and assist in tasks that are not directly related to my staff position.
I agree to all these statements and understand that I will be held accountable to them.
